Through the unique dual-screen setup of the DS, players could easily switch between various tasks, making it feel as though they were genuinely cooking in their own kitchen. Titles like “Cooking Mama” benefited from this design, allowing players to interactively prepare meals using touch controls and stylus movements. Released in 2006, “Cooking Mama” alone sold over 3 million copies worldwide, showcasing the popularity of the genre. With so many titles available, it’s easy to understand why the best cooking Nintendo DS games have garnered such a passionate following.
As you dive deeper into these games, you’ll find that each title offers a unique perspective on cooking, from traditional recipes to whimsical dishes. Games like “Cake Mania” and “Diner Dash” bring time management into the mix, challenging players not just to cook but to serve hungry customers efficiently. Meanwhile, “Personal Trainer: Cooking” encourages players to hone their culinary skills with real recipes, many of which are designed for the actual kitchen—a fantastic feature that bridges the gap between virtual cooking and real-life application.
